    About The Role

     

    As a Software Engineering Manager at CBRE, you will drive the design, development, and delivery of full-stack solutions supporting our business objectives. You will lead a team of developers, focusing on .NET Core API development, Snowflake database integration, React-based frontends, Python for Automation, and deployment on AWS cloud platforms. The ideal candidate will possess deep technical expertise, strong leadership skills, and a proven track record of delivering complex projects.

    What You’ll Do

    + Lead the architecture, development, and deployment of scalable full-stack applications using .NET Core, Snowflake, React, and cloud technologies (AWS/Azure).

    + Guide and mentor a team of software engineers, fostering collaboration and professional growth.

    + Oversee project delivery, ensuring timelines, quality standards, and business requirements are met.

    + Collaborate with cross-functional teams to define technical solutions aligned with business goals.

    + Establish coding standards, best practices, and review processes to maintain code quality and security.

    + Manage cloud infrastructure setup, CI/CD pipelines, and application monitoring for optimal performance.

    + Create and maintain Python scripts for automation, data tooling, and operational tasks.

    + Troubleshoot and resolve complex technical issues across the stack.

    + Communicate project status, risks, and opportunities to stakeholders and senior management.

    + Identify opportunities for process improvement, automation, and innovation within the development lifecycle.

    + Ensure compliance with security protocols, data privacy regulations, and industry best practices.

    What you'll need

     

    To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to execute each essential duty satisfactorily.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form essential functions.

     

    +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or related field; Master’s degree is a plus.

    + 7+ years of experience in full-stack software development.

    + 3+ years of experience leading development teams and delivering enterprise projects.

    + Expertise in .NET Core API development and integration.

    + Hands-on experience with Snowflake or similar cloud-based databases.

    + Proficiency in React for building modern, responsive frontends.

    + Strong experience with AWS or Azure cloud platforms, including deployment and infrastructure management.

    + Solid understanding of CI/CD, DevOps practices, and application monitoring.

    + Proficiency with Python for scripting and automation (e.g., build tooling, data utilities, operational scripts).

    + Excellent problem-solving, analytical, and communication skills.

    + Ability to collaborate effectively with technical and non-technical stakeholders.

    + Experience with agile methodologies and project management tools.

    + Knowledge of security best practices and compliance standards.

    + Relevant certifications in cloud technologies or software engineering are preferred.
